Yellow Jackets Notch First-Ever Win Over UMary in Rimrock Classic Opener

BILLINGS, Mont. - The Black Hills State University women's soccer team improved their record to 2-0-1 on Thursday night at the Yellowjacket Soccer Field, notching their best 3-game start to a season in program history while also capturing their first-ever win over UMary with a 4-2 victory. Despite being outshot 30-15 and 9-7 in shots on goal, the Yellow Jackets never trailed as another balanced offensive attack saw three different players score, including a pair from true freshman Ivy Agee. Fueling that offensive attack was 5th year Rapid City native Kylea Becker, as she assisted on two corner kick set pieces and became the school's single season assist record holder with four through just three matches.

HOW IT HAPPENED 

  • The Black Hills State offensive attack capitalized on a corner kick opportunity in the 10th minute of action, scoring on their first shot attempt of the match-up as Ally Boysen sent a header into the net off a Kylea Becker assist to give the Yellow Jackets a 1-0 advantage. 
  • Then just minutes later Rian Barthel was able to save and deflect the first shot attempt away from Harlee Peltz; however, Cate Jesena was able to follow and place the ball into an empty left side of the net to even the match at one in the 12th minute. 
  • The Green & Gold were able to break the tie in the 44th minute and grab a 2-1 advantage entering the half, as Ivy Agee again showed off her scoring abilities with a strike from beyond the top of the penalty box that found a window between the outstretched arms of the keeper and the top of the woodwork. 
  • It didn't take long for Black Hills State to strike again in the second half, as Samantha Nunez notched her first goal as a Yellow Jacket off another set piece assist from Becker, scoring the game-winner on a header from the back post in the 51st minute. 
  • The Marauders continued to battle and fought back within a goal (3-2) in the 71st minute that saw Lillian Schatz score from 40-yards out off an assist from Dina Polanco, with the ball taking a high bounce into the net as Barthel lost her footing in the turf. 
  • Barthel recovered and kept the Marauders at bay the remainder of the match, including a spell in the 77th minute where she had to make a pair of saves. During the attack, Zoe Evans first deflected a pass into the box that then led to a Jesena shot saved and deflected by Barthel. Eventually the final shot of the flurry went off target from Addison Massey. 
  • The Yellow Jackets shut the door on any UMary late comeback in the 87th minute, as a long pass forward out of the corner from Becker led to a quick length of the field counter attack from Agee. She then proceeded to outrun the defense and placed the ball over Elena van Heukelom and into the top right corner of the net to make it a 4-2 match.
